2

Windows での vim- foreplay は、コードを nrepl (知らない人のための Java プロセス) に送信することを含むことを行うときに非常に遅いことに気付きました。Ruby ではそれが行われていると思います。私は、Ruby 1.9.3 を使用するCream 7.3.762 なしの Vim と、Ruby 1.9.3 を使用する公式の Vim Windows インストーラーからインストールされた Vim で試しました (このバージョンを Ruby 1.8 で動作させることはできませんでした。それがどのように機能するか、そしてそれが機能するはずかどうかを知っています)。どちらも vim-foreplay を合わせると非常に遅く、何かを送信して評価するのに約 1 秒かかりました。しかし、Ruby 1.8 用にビルドされた Cream 7.3.289 を使用しない Vim は、はるかに高速です。評価は瞬時に。どうして?

4

1 に答える 1

0

どうやら、Windows 上の Ruby 1.9.3-p362 でlocalhostwithへの接続を開くのは遅いようですが、toの方がはるかに高速です。TCPSocket.open()127.0.0.1

これを見つけるのを手伝ってくれたhttps://github.com/tpopeに感謝します。

于 2013-01-03T22:17:31.867 に答える